]> git.cworth.org Git - apitrace/blobdiff - specs/scripts/Makefile
egltrace: Refresh EGLenum from upstream.
[apitrace] / specs / scripts / Makefile
index 2ea20661c0544c53edb4fb6d475d07b99405c83e..339de1ef4b0195610b91c27addddb90809854fff 100644 (file)
@@ -1,8 +1,12 @@
 
 all: \
        download \
-       glapi.py glxapi.py wglapi.py \
-    glparams.py wglenum.py
+       glapi.py \
+       glparams.py \
+       glxapi.py \
+       wglapi.py \
+       wglenum.py \
+       eglenum.py
 
 download: \
        enum.spec \
@@ -18,7 +22,8 @@ download: \
        wglenumext.spec \
        wgl.spec \
        wglext.spec \
-       wgl.tm
+       wgl.tm \
+       eglenum.spec
 
 %.spec:
        wget -N http://www.opengl.org/registry/api/$@
@@ -26,6 +31,9 @@ download: \
 %.tm:
        wget -N http://www.opengl.org/registry/api/$@
 
+eglenum.spec:
+       wget -N http://www.khronos.org/registry/egl/api/$@
+
 glapi.py: glspec.py gl.tm gl.spec
        python glspec.py gl gl.tm gl.spec > $@
 
@@ -41,6 +49,9 @@ glparams.py: glparams.sed enum.spec sort.sh
 wglenum.py: wglenum.sh wglenumext.spec
        ./wglenum.sh wglenumext.spec > $@
 
+eglenum.py: eglenum.sh eglenum.spec
+       ./eglenum.sh eglenum.spec > $@
+
 clean:
        rm -f \
         glapi.py glxapi.py wglapi.py \